About the Company

Loïc Labouche first set up HC Resources in Lyon in 1999, with the aim of providing commercial training and legal and social consulting services. Today HC Resources comprises all DOMINO group subsidiaries specialising in HR. The company has gained recognition for its expertise under the dynamic leadership of Edouard Stiegler (associate director of the subsidiary and head of HR consulting for the group since 2005), and then Olivier Bellintani (in charge of all coaching and management business since 2006). Now undertaking over 300 assignments a year, the company continues to develop its business in Poland, Switzerland and the Netherlands.

Job Description
Job Title: Commercial Development Director – Building Envelope (H/F) Role Summary: Lead B2B commercial growth for PVC and aluminium building envelope solutions across a regional territory. Drive new business, manage client relationships, and coordinate project delivery with design, construction, and supply teams. Expectations: Deliver measurable sales targets, expand the client base of contractors, developers, and housing providers, and ensure the company’s building envelope products secure a competitive position in new and refurbishment projects. Key Responsibilities: - Conduct proactive prospecting with general contractors, developers, and social housing entities. - Own the commercial relationship for supply and installation projects in new builds and renovations. - Prepare and respond to public and private tenders: analyze dossiers, perform technical qualification, and coordinate with studies teams. - Assess interfaces with other building envelope trades (structure, façade, waterproofing, core) and contribute to project selection. - Implement a prescription strategy targeting architects, design offices, and prescribers. - Build and maintain a network of partner artisans for supply-only engagements. - Collaborate closely with studies and construction teams on feasibility, site surveys, and file triage. - Travel regularly within the region; maintain occasional weekend commitments as required. Required Skills: - Proven B2B sales experience in the building sector, preferably in second‑works or building envelope. - Strong knowledge of public and private procurement processes and contract management. - Ability to evaluate projects technically and incorporate economic viability. - Familiarity with building thermal and acoustic performance regulations. - Excellent relationship building, negotiation, and communication skills. - Self‑motivated, organized, and field‑savvy with a project‑centric mindset. Required Education & Certifications: - Higher education in commerce, building, civil engineering, architecture, or equivalent. - Minimum of 3–5 years commercial development experience in the construction industry.
